Veterinary/animal clinics P P P P (a) As provided on the Street Designation Map.

(b) Permitted only on lots abutting portions of Del Prado Boulevard north of Cape Coral Parkway. (c) Not permitted as a single use. (d) Not permitted on lots abutting portions of Southeast 47th Terrace with a street designation of secondary. (e) For buildings within 150 feet of any residential zoning district, such uses shall only be permitted as a special exception. The distance shall be measured in a straight line between the nearest point of the building for which the use is proposed and the nearest point of the residential property line. (f) Dwelling units shall not be permitted on the first story on lots abutting portions of Southeast 47th Terrace with a street designation of secondary. (g) Permitted only as a component of compound use development. (h) Dwelling units shall not be permitted on the first story. (i) Indoor only. (j) Permitted only in conjunction with retail sales, without outdoor storage. (k) Neighborhood storage facility shall be provided in accordance with 2.7.15.D.14. (l) Storage, enclosed shall be provided in accordance with 2.7.15.D.15. (m) Liquid chemical tanks shall be provided in accordance with 2.7.15.D.16. (n) Allowed only as a special exception use if production levels exceed those allowed for a permitted use as provided in Table SC-9.

TABLE SC-9 MAXIMUM PRODUCTION LIMITS FOR ARTISAN BREWERIES, DISTILLERIES, AND WINERIES Use Maximum Production per Calendar Year as a Permitted Use Maximum Production per Calendar Year as a Special Exception Use Artisan brewery 10,000 barrels(a) 20,000 barrels(a) Artisan distillery 40,000 proof gallons(b) 75,000 proof gallons(b) Artisan winery 3,000 cases(c) 5,000 cases(c) (a) One barrel is equivalent to 31 gallons of beer. (b) A unit of measure defined as one gallon of spirits that is 50% alcohol at 60 degrees Fahrenheit. (c) One standard case is equivalent to 12 bottles with each bottle containing 750 ml.
